14 THIS MATTER comes before the Court on Talisman Specialty Underwriters, Inc.’s 15 (“Talisman”) motion to intervene (Dkt. No. 24), and Defendant Ares Insurance Managers LLC’s 16 (“Ares”) surreply motion to strike (Dkt. No. 36). Having reviewed these filings and the balance 17 of the docket, the Court ORDERS: 18 1) The evidentiary hearing on Plaintiff Texas Insurance Company’s (“TIC”) motion 19 for preliminary injunction scheduled for November 6, 2023 is converted to oral argument on the 20 motion to intervene (Dkt. No. 24) at 10:00 a.m. on November 6, 2023, in Courtroom 16206. At 21 that hearing, counsel shall be prepared to address the applicability of the first-to-file rule, with 22 respect to Case No. 2:23-cv-03412 pending in the Eastern District of Louisiana. See, e.g., Kohn 23 Law Group, Inc. v. Auto Parts Mfg. Mississippi, Inc., 787 F.3d 1237 (9th Cir. 2015). 24 1 Counsel for TIC, Ares, and Talisman should further be prepared to address the following 2 at the November 6 hearing: 3 i. Talisman describes the Louisiana action as “concurrent,” and claims that in that

4 action TIC “alleges substantially the same allegations as here” and “seeks the same 5 relief.” Dkt. No. 24 at 3. Do TIC and Ares agree with that characterization of the 6 Louisiana action? If not, what distinguishes the issues raised in the Louisiana 7 action from those in this action? 8 ii. Are the parties to the Louisiana action substantially similar to the parties in this 9 case? Does your answer depend on whether the motion to intervene is granted? 10 iii. Ares has stated that if TIC’s motion for preliminary injunction currently pending in 11 the Louisiana action is granted, it would moot this case. Dkt. No. 32 at 5. Do TIC 12 and Talisman agree?

13 iv. Would a stay of this case pending resolution of the Louisiana action maximize 14 judicial economy, consistency, and comity? If this case is not stayed, is there a risk 15 of multiple inconsistent judgments on the same issues? 16 2) Ares’s motion to strike (Dkt. No. 36) is DENIED. However, Ares is granted leave 17 to file a supplemental response addressing the material submitted in the Second Supplemental 18 Declaration of Jeffrey Silver no later than Monday, November 13, 2023. 19 Dated this 30th day of October, 2023. 20 A 21 Kymberly K.
